| R-C-6004 | 9A1P9 | 9A1P9 is a multi-tail ionizable phospholipid which promotes membrane destabilization and cargo release, enhancing mRNA delivery and gene editing.Lipid nanoparticles prepared with 9A1P9 exhibited 40- to 965-fold higher in vivo mRNA delivery efficacy compared to DOPE and DSPC.The product is only suitable for scientific research experiments and is not intended for human or clinical use. | price> |

| R-C-6006 | AA3-DLin CAS:2832061-33-1 | AA3-DLin is an ionizable lipid used in generating lipid nanoparticles(LNPs)for RNA delivery.Unlike LNPs formulated with other ionizable lipids,AA3-DLin LNPs performed best with higher proportions of phospholipid and lower cholesterol(40:40:25:0.5 AA3-DLin/DOPE/cholesterol/DMG-PEG).AA3-DLin containing LNPs were able to deliver full-length SARS-COV2 spike protein mRNA to BALB/c mice and generate a strong immune response.The product is only suitable for scientific research experiments and is not intended for human or clinical use. | price> |

| R-C-6007 | ALC-0159 1849616-42-7 | ALC-0159 is a PEG/lipid conjugate(PEGylated lipid),specifically, it is the N,N-dimyristylamide of 2-hydroxyacetic acid,O-pegylated to a PEG chain mass of about 2 kilodaltons (corresponding to about 45-46 ethylene oxide units per molecule of N,N-dimyristyl hydroxyacetamide).It is a non-ionic surfactant by its nature.The product is only suitable for scientific research experiments and is not intended for human or clinical use. | price> |
